Massively's sister site WoW Insider pointed out some news regarding Blizzard today. WoW Insider's Mike Schrammwrites that Blizzard Entertainment seems to have made a big impact on the MI6 Conference, which is focused on the marketing and monetization of games. Blizzard is a nominee in six award categories for the 2009 MI6 Awards, most of them for World of Warcraft:

OUTSTANDING TV OR THEATRICAL AD
Ozzy Osborne - "Prince of Darkness"

OUTSTANDING TV OR THEATRICAL CAMPAIGN
World of Warcraft 2008 "What's your Game?" TV Campaign

BEST WRAPPING - PRODUCT PACKAGING
Wrath of the Lich King Standard Edition

OUTSTANDING OVERALL MARKETING CAMPAIGN
World of Warcraft: Wrath of the Lich King Launch Campaign

SHARPEST PEN AWARD - BEST COPYWRITING/TV OR THEATRICAL
Ozzy Osborne - "Prince of Darkness"

BEST PRODUCT LOGO DESIGN
Diablo 3 Animated Logo

The MI6 Conference will be held on April 8th in San Francisco.
